No Tiger Woods and no Karl Vilips, the little-known Australian carrying the flag for golfing royalty. It is only Friday but already Rory McIlroy, Scottie Scheffler and Co are already fielding questions about the atmosphere here - and the hole left by a 15-time major champion and his ruptured Achilles. After it was confirmed that he would miss this Players Championships, Woods' only footprint at this event was wrapped around the shoulders of his protege, Vilips. The Australian is ranked No 106 in the world. He is a PGA Tour rookie who qualified for this event by winning the Puerto Rico Open. 'Just a dream come true,' he said. It was his first PGA Tour victory in just his third start as a professional. Vilips grew up idolizing Woods and last month he was named as the first ambassador for Woods' clothing brand: Sun Day Red, named after his iconic look for the final rounds of events. 'We were drawn towards his relentless work ethic and pioneering spirit that embody what we stand for,' Woods said. 'I have no doubt he... is one of the game’s future stars.' Since then, however, Sun Day Red only had a few outings. Here at The Players, Vilips failed to make it to the weekend. The 23-year-old gave himself a decent chance of making the cut after finishing his opening round on even par. But then, on Friday, he plummeted down the leaderboard. His first six holes of the second round included three bogeys and a double bogey. Another double bogey and another bogey followed. He finished on six-over-par after a 78. At the time of writing, only one player in the entire field had shot worse. Both Vilips and Woods wore red during their college days at Stanford. On Friday, the Australian was decked out in pink as his maiden Players Championship campaign ended early. Instead, the lasting headlines this week came courtesy of Woods' private life. On Thursday, DailyMail.com exclusively revealed that the golf legend and Vanessa Trump, the ex-wife of Donald Jr, have been dating since Thanksgiving. Vanessa is the mother of Kai Trump, the teen golf star who has already rubbed shoulders with some of the biggest names in the sport. Vilips is another young prospect now tied to the greatest golfer of his era. Unfortunately he couldn't inspire the Australian to a four-day run at The Players. Instead, the likes of Xander Schauffele were left to articulate what the absence of Woods does to events such as this. 'There's a reason it's called the Tiger effect,' Schauffele said. 'Scottie, Rory and I, we're not going to be throwing our shoulders out fist pumping anything, so I'm sure that would fire a crowd up a little bit more. 'We didn't have a whole lot to fist pump at, to be completely honest... all the guys in the group typically play pretty good golf, but no one does it better than Tiger.'
